What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Machine Operator,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Machine Operator, you need mechanical aptitude, attention to detail, and a high school diploma or equivalent, often supplemented by on-the-job training. Familiarity with CNC machines, production line equipment, and safety protocols is typically required, and certifications such as OSHA or forklift operation can be advantageous. Strong problem-solving abilities, teamwork, and communication skills help you adapt to changing production needs and minimize downtime. These skills and qualities are crucial for maintaining efficient operations, ensuring product quality, and promoting a safe work environment.

What are Machine Operators?

Machine Operators are skilled workers who set up, operate, and maintain machinery in manufacturing or production environments. They are responsible for monitoring equipment, performing quality checks, and ensuring that machines run efficiently and safely. Machine Operators may work with a variety of machines, such as CNC equipment, presses, or assembly line devices. Their duties often include troubleshooting mechanical issues and adhering to safety protocols to maintain a productive workplace.

Job Description

Machine Operator

Downingtown, PA

Compensation Includes

  • Starting rate at $23.70/hour
  • Pay differential added for 2nd shift and 3rd shift

Available Shifts

  • 2nd: 3:00pm - 11:00pm 

  • 3rd: 11:00pm - 7:00am 

Responsibilities

  • Consistently operates zone of forming machines at or above standard levels considering waste, efficiency and utilization
  • Troubleshoot causes of machine malfunctions
  • Make appropriate adjustments or repairs to ensure that the quality of the cartons meeting specifications and that the machines operate properly
  • Conducts quality checks at regular intervals and takes corrective action to fix defects identified
  • Performs minor repairs during production
  • Performs changeovers
  • Performs weekly machine maintenance
  • Communicates with the operator from the previous and following shifts and with supervisors to review any problems experienced on the machines throughout the department
  • Performs purge procedures when changing to a new product and completes the required checklists
  • Follows LOTO and alternative LOTO procedures
  • Maintains a clean and orderly work area

Qualifications

  • 1+ year of experience operating machinery in a manufacturing environment
  • Some mechanical experience prefrerred 
  • HS diploma or GED equivalent is required
  • The ability to read and understand safety protocols and equipment manuals written in English is required
